To write CXLIX in numbers, first analyse the symbols used in this Roman numeral to break it into parts and then replace each symbol with numbers to add them together.
Steps to Convert CXLIX Roman Numerals into Number:
Converting CXLIX in number involves breaking each numeral and writing it seperately to replace it with the respective number. Below is the step by step explanation of this conversion:
Check the symbol used in CXLIX: C = 100, L = 50, X =10, and I = 1
Break and write the Roman numeral CXLIX into parts: CXLIX = C + (L - X) + (X - I)
Replace each Roman numeral with its value in numbers: CXLIX = 100 + (50 - 10) + (10 - 1) = 100 + 40 + 9
Now, add them together to form the final number: CXLIX = 149
Hence, CXLIX represents 149 in numbers.

There are 4 fundamental Roman numeral rules that we need to follow for writing or converting Roman numbers correctly.
Addition Rule: When smaller numerals follow larger ones, their values are added.
Example: VI = 5 + 1 = 6
Subtraction Rule: When a smaller numeral comes before a larger one, it is subtracted.
Example: IX = 10 - 1 = 9
Repetition Rule: Symbols I, X, C, and M can be repeated up to three times.
Example: XXX = 30
Non-Repetition Rule: Symbols V, L, and D cannot be repeated.
